Transaction f316bfdc632b1fddfba623ee065a1d14f7ee1234a6df4aa0bed5fe6fc0aca154
1 Input
1 Output
-
f316bfdc632b1fddfba623ee065a1d14f7ee1234a6df4aa0bed5fe6fc0aca154:0
- value
- 149949
- script pubkey
- OP_0 OP_PUSHBYTES_20 3507cb1497713e87d7cac26386d8a0d5f5adf69f
- address
- bc1qx5ruk9yhwylg0472cf3cdk9q6h66ma5lhxkypa